The Lancer L5AWM 300BLK Magazine has been specifically engineered for use with 300 Blackout ammunition, particularly 200+ grain subsonic cartridges. The updated internal geometry allows these longer heavier bullets to stack properly, which increases reliability when compared to a traditional .223/5.56 magazine.
The L5AWM is short for L5 Advanced Warfighter Magazine, as it was designed to be the ultimate AR-15 magazine for military, law enforcement, and competition. This .300 AAC Blackout magazine offers the reliability and endurance of traditional steel magazines, while still offering the weight and maneuverability of advanced, light polymer.
Its hardened steel lip assembly and anti-tilt follower promise excellent feeding into the firearm. Moving on, its advanced polymer body offers micro-stipple pyramids for excellent grip and control.
The outside of the magazine body is molded with 300 Blackout markings and the magazine ships with a contrasting flat dark earth base plate for easy visual identification.
Designed, tooled, manufactured, and assembled in the USA.
NOTE: These magazines have been specifically designed and optimized to alleviate the stacking and feeding issues commonly experienced when running 200+ grain subsonic .300BLK cartridges in standard .223/5.56 magazines. If you are shooting lightweight supersonic .300BLK ammunition (<150gr), we recommend using a standard .223/5.56 L5AWM magazine.
